黑狐家游戏

cpu 虚拟化,cpu虚拟化有什么用

欧气 2 0

本文目录导读:

  1. 提高资源利用率
  2. 灵活的部署和管理
  3. 隔离和安全性
  4. 支持多租户环境
  5. 应用兼容性
  6. 动态资源分配
  7. 创新应用

《CPU 虚拟化:开启计算新时代的关键技术》

在当今数字化的时代,计算机技术的发展日新月异,而 CPU 虚拟化作为一项关键技术,正逐渐改变着我们对计算的理解和应用方式,CPU 虚拟化是一种将物理 CPU 资源虚拟化成多个逻辑 CPU 的技术,它为计算机系统带来了诸多优势和创新应用。

提高资源利用率

CPU 虚拟化的首要作用是显著提高物理 CPU 资源的利用率,在传统的计算机系统中,一台物理服务器通常只能运行一个操作系统和一组应用程序,即使在服务器的负载较低时,大部分物理 CPU 资源也处于闲置状态,而通过 CPU 虚拟化技术,可以在一台物理服务器上同时运行多个虚拟机(VM),每个虚拟机都可以像独立的物理服务器一样运行自己的操作系统和应用程序,这样一来,物理服务器的资源可以被多个虚拟机共享,从而大大提高了资源的利用率,降低了服务器的硬件成本。

灵活的部署和管理

CPU 虚拟化还为系统的部署和管理带来了极大的灵活性,传统的服务器部署需要在物理硬件上进行安装和配置,而 CPU 虚拟化使得服务器的部署可以在软件层面上进行,只需要在物理服务器上安装虚拟化软件,然后在虚拟化软件中创建虚拟机即可,这种方式不仅大大简化了服务器的部署过程,还可以实现快速的服务器迁移和备份,提高了系统的可用性和可靠性。

隔离和安全性

CPU 虚拟化提供了良好的隔离机制,使得不同的虚拟机之间相互隔离,互不干扰,每个虚拟机都拥有自己独立的操作系统、内存、存储和网络资源,即使一个虚拟机出现故障或受到攻击,也不会影响到其他虚拟机的正常运行,CPU 虚拟化还可以通过硬件辅助的安全技术,如 Intel VT-x 和 AMD-V 等,来增强系统的安全性,防止恶意软件和黑客的攻击。

支持多租户环境

在云计算和数据中心等多租户环境中,CPU 虚拟化是必不可少的技术,通过 CPU 虚拟化,可以将物理服务器划分为多个虚拟机,每个虚拟机可以分配给不同的租户使用,实现了资源的灵活分配和共享,这样一来,云计算服务提供商可以为多个租户提供高效、可靠的计算资源,同时保证每个租户的隐私和安全。

应用兼容性

CPU 虚拟化技术可以在不修改现有应用程序的情况下,在虚拟机中运行这些应用程序,这使得企业可以在现有硬件基础上,逐步引入虚拟化技术,实现应用程序的平滑迁移和升级,CPU 虚拟化还可以支持不同操作系统和硬件平台之间的迁移,为企业的业务连续性提供了有力保障。

动态资源分配

CPU 虚拟化技术可以实现动态的资源分配,根据虚拟机的实际需求,自动调整 CPU、内存、存储和网络资源的分配,这样一来,系统可以在保证性能的前提下,最大限度地提高资源的利用率,避免了资源的浪费。

创新应用

除了以上传统的应用场景外,CPU 虚拟化还为许多创新应用提供了可能,在容器技术中,CPU 虚拟化可以用于实现容器的隔离和资源管理;在大数据和人工智能领域,CPU 虚拟化可以用于加速数据处理和模型训练。

CPU 虚拟化作为一项关键技术,为计算机系统带来了诸多优势和创新应用,它不仅提高了资源利用率,降低了硬件成本,还为系统的部署和管理带来了极大的灵活性,同时提供了良好的隔离和安全性,支持多租户环境,实现了应用程序的兼容性和动态资源分配,为未来的计算发展奠定了坚实的基础,随着技术的不断进步,CPU 虚拟化技术将不断完善和创新,为我们的生活和工作带来更多的便利和价值。

标签: #CPU 虚拟化 #资源整合 #性能优化 #灵活性提升

黑狐家游戏
  • 评论列表

留言评论